MAMMA MIA here we go again!

Hey!
I was invited to the Family and Friends show, playing the evening prior to opening night for Mamma Mia in Sydney, Australia.
Most people haven`t been to a run like this. The director and team are set up front of house in the theatre. The show is formally introduced to the audience and you as the audience, consisting of family and friends of the artists, are rooting for the performers to do their very best. Command the laughs, perform all of the choreography with precision, hit every note and feed off of the energy of the audience.

Sorry to get political, but...

I have to say I'm extremely disappointed with the election results in Maine last Tuesday regarding same-sex marriage. This was the first time that the American populate repealed actual legislation regarding same-sex marriage; last year's measure in California was in response to a court ruling, not law. The legislation that would have granted gays the right to wed was defeated with a vote of 53%-47%.

Lady Gaga to Perform with Bolshoi Ballet

According to the New York Times ArtsBeat Blog, superstar singer Lady Gaga will be performing with dancers from the Bolshoi Ballet in Los Angeles at a gala for the Museum of Contemporary Art on Nov. 14. A news release issued by the museum stated that Francesco Vezzoli has been commissioned to create the production, entitled "Ballets Russes Italian Style (The Shortest Musical You Will Never See Again)." The show will also debut Lady Gaga's new single, "Speechless."
